Singer Joshi of ‘Kanchhi Matyang Tyang’-fame dies

Birtamod, July 26: A gifted singer of folk songs, Laxmi Prasad (LP) Joshi, has passed away. He was 88. Joshi had fell unconscious at his house at Damak-1 on Thursday evening and was rushed to the local Lifeline Hospital where he breathed his last under treatment. Born in 1993 BS
